John,

It looks like a blower manifold to me with a fabricated scoop type arangment bolted on. Notice the plugs for down nozzels above the port openings. Indy makes one that looks a lot like that one. I am sure these manfolds are out on the market. Good luck.

Tom G.

PS. I see Indy sells an aluminum blower manifold for both 10 and 16 bolt heads that looks identical to the one in the picture. Price $995.
